NAPPANEE - Daniel E. Smith, 43, of 1008 Meadows, Nappanee, died at 2:45 a.m. May 30, 2007, in his residence.

He was born June 4, 1963, in Mishawaka, to Walter and Pamela Neff Smith. On Aug. 2, 1997, in Elkhart, he married Brenda Prater, who survives.

A lifetime area resident, he was a Jimtown High School graduate. He was a welder at Hochstetler Grain for 11 years. He also worked part-time in security for Jim Miller private investigation.

Also surviving are his mother, Pamela Smith, Elkhart; two daughters, Mrs. Chad (Christina) Hochstetler, Nappanee, and Tiffani Smith, Mishawaka; five sons: Bryon Jones, Nappanee; Carl Edward Smith, at home; Logan Alan Smith and Timothy Tucker, both of South Bend; and Kenny Bicknell, Elkhart; seven grandchildren; six brothers: Michael, Walter C. and Mickey Joe Smith, all of Elkhart; Jonathon Smith, Middlebury; Matthew Smith, Shipshewana; and Jason Smith, Phoenix, Ariz.; two sisters, Mrs. Dana (Elizabeth) Platz, Nappanee, and Mrs. Victor (Angel) Sanchez, Elkhart. He was preceded in death by his father and a sister.

Services will be at 10:30 a.m. Saturday at Thompson-Lengacher & Yoder Funeral Home, Nappanee, with the Rev. Terry Tyler officiating. Burial will be in Whitehead Cemetery, New Paris.

Calling is from 5 to 8 p.m. Friday at the funeral home.
